Glendale Adventist Medical Center: Working with High Tech and High Touch

The Glendale Adventist Medical Center was founded in 1905 by the Seventh-day Adventist Church; the hospital was created with the mission of sharing God's love with its community by promoting healing and wellness for the whole person.

Through the years the hospital has been working with the latest technology and equipments to provide the patients the best recovery in a compassionate environment. The balance between the technology and the high quality of the human staff has made of the Glendale Center one of the most recognized hospitals in the area.

The services in the center are several, such as, Behavioral Medicine, Child Care Connections, Diabetes Care, Emergency, Heart and Vascular Services, Hyperbaric Oxygen Therapy, Neuroscience, Occupational Medicine; along with Rehabilitation, Sleep Disorders Center, Surgery and Women's Services. All those services are supported by state-of-the-art equipments like Spiral CT Scanner, or Image Checker.

The Glendale Adventist Medical Center delivers care in a way that respects the privacy and humanity of the patients and besides the excellence in medical services it provides the community with education programs and support groups that allow residents of the community to learn about different diseases; in addition the center provides medical attention to those kids who their families can not afford health care.

The center has nearly 2,000 employees, 650 physicians, and more than 400 volunteers, who provide health in body, mind and spirit. In addition, Glendale Medical Center has the policy of providing personalized care in a community with several ethnic and cultural differences; therefore, the center has services of translation, spiritual care and other needs that patients may have.
